Output ef4306de49c19cf2a180e6f751a6c9d572e36bf8512e8b3141f2e4e045a25dfe:0

value
1724094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c7dea9dcb93c620a16f36006afd685ab1c3f6f OP_EQUAL
address
3LzowDTsyQjU58rfUkUtDFq8JzQ2A8MXGV
transaction
ef4306de49c19cf2a180e6f751a6c9d572e36bf8512e8b3141f2e4e045a25dfe
confirmations
385177
spent
true